Abstract

The invention relates to an automatic recovery speed-limiting sorting tube or wire winder. The middle of a shell is connected with a disc body in a rotating mode through a wheel shaft, a volute spiral spring is arranged in the disc body, one end of the volute spiral spring is connected with the wheel shaft, and the other end of the volute spiral spring is connected with the disc body. Tubes or electric wires are wound on the disc body. A sorting device used for the tubes or the wires is arranged on a tube or wire outlet of the front end of the shell. A speed limiting device used for slowly recovering the tubes or the wires is arranged between the side face of the disc body and the shell. Compared with the prior art, due to the fact that the sorting device and the speed limiting device for slow recovering are arranged on the automatic recovery tube or wire winder at the same time, the ordered arrangement of the tubes or the electric wires on the disc body can be achieved, the purpose for controlling and limiting the rotating speed of the disc body can also be achieved, hence, on the premise that the automatic recovery tube or wire winding function is not changed, the safety of a user can be protected, and the tube or wire winder, connected tools and the like cannot be damaged. The sorting device and the speed limiting device are simple in structure and can be mounted and used in an existing automatic recovery tube or wire winder.

Background technology
At present, automatically reclaim mainly to be reclaimed to drive with motor by Spring driving around pipe or bobbin winoler and reclaim two kinds of forms.Motor drives recovery type automatic pipe winding device to be to drive pipe winding disk rotation to realize the withdrawal of pipe or electric wire by electric machine rotation, owing to this electric motor type automatic pipe winding, line device need motor to be used as power, structure is complicated, cost is high, and need external power supply, especially for the tube wrapping device of the inflammable and explosive fluid of conveying, with greater need for installing explosion-protection equipment additional.Spring driving reclaims automatic tube wrapping device or bobbin winoler is to drive pipe winding disk rotation to realize the withdrawal of pipe or electric wire by the restoring force of spring of crispaturaing.Such as Chinese patent, application number 200510060743.9, disclosing a kind of power cord spooling machine on February 2nd, 2006, it is by Wiinding cartridge, spring assembly of crispaturaing, and constitutes around electrical cord assembly, electrical connection module and stop conjugative component.
Wherein, spring assembly of crispaturaing includes spring leaf of crispaturaing, and one end, spring leaf center of crispaturaing is fixed with Wiinding cartridge by spring shaft core of crispaturaing, and spring leaf cylindrical one end of crispaturaing is fixed on reel.When pulling in time being entangled in reel power source line, reel rotates and drives one end of the spring leaf of crispaturaing in reel to rotate, the spring leaf that makes to crispatura rolls tightly and produces the power of crispaturaing, when decontroling power line, the recovered original form of spring leaf of crispaturaing and drive reel adverse movement, make power line be wound on reel withdrawal.
Stop conjugative component includes that left and right friction plate, left and right strut the extremely peripheral back-moving spring of bar, arresting lever and be located at its peripheral reset key of Vertical post pole of arresting lever end and be located at the button of arresting lever upper end.When pressing the button, depressing arresting lever, make to strut bar about arresting lever compressing and open, make left and right friction plate compress the inwall of reel, make reel stop operating, meanwhile Vertical post is also to bottom offset, compresses the coiling axle sleeve rotated, and switch on power a contact.Button be can SR, after pressing power supply, by back-moving spring elastic reaction so that it is reset of rebounding the most on time, button also can with gradual with control resilience force reach control take-up speed.
Owing to spring leaf of crispaturaing gradually recovers to export torque, reel angular velocity turns faster and faster, and along with on reel increasing around electric wire, can be around the enlarged diameter of electric wire on reel, the linear velocity making reel is increasing, i.e. power line reclaims into the speed in bobbin winoler increasing, the safety of entail dangers to user and the destruction causing bobbin winoler and connected instrument etc..If using above-mentioned stop device reel can only be made to stop operating by manual operation, or gradual control resilience force reaches to control take-up speed purpose, the most necessarily loses function and the effect of recovery automatically.It addition, in prior art, have ranking function around pipe, line utensil, but the most do not reclaim automatic speed limiting function.

The effect of collator and operation principle:
Manually pipe or electric wire 21 are all pulled out during work, disk body 9 drives pipe or electric wire 21 to rotate under the elastic force effect of scroll spring and reclaims, the big synchronous pulley 10 being arranged on disk body 9 while disk body 9 rotates is rotated by Timing Belt 22 and the little wheel 19 drive sequence axle 18 that synchronizes, then drive pipe guidance set 14 to move axially along sequence direction of principal axis, thus drive pipe or the electric wire 21 ordered arrangement on disk body 9.
The effect of speed-limiting device and operation principle:
Pipe is during automatically reclaiming, and reclaiming speed due to the effect of inertia can be increasingly faster, brings potential safety hazard to product and use.The slow speed-limiting device reclaimed drives the slow gear 6 that reclaims to rotate by the internal gear on disk body, after the recovery rotary speed of disk body 9 reaches to a certain degree, its elastic-friction sheet 6 outer ring is because of elastic effect meeting outward expansion, then friction is produced with inside the drag ring 8 being arranged on housing 1, so that the rotary speed of disk body 9 declines, it is ensured that the recovery speed of pipe or electric wire 21 is steady.
